Bhaskar Reddy %J International Journal of Applied Mathematics and Computation %D 2009 %I PSIT Kanpur %X In this article, we studied the effects of variable viscosity and thermal conductivity on an unsteady two-dimensional laminar flow of a viscous incompressible electrically conducting fluid past a semi-infinite vertical porous moving plate taking into account the mass transfer. The fluid viscosity is assumed to vary as a linear function of temperature. It is assumed that the porous plate moves with a constant velocity in the direction of fluid flow, and the free stream velocity follows the exponentially increasing small perturbation law. The governing equations for the flow are transformed into a system of non-linear ordinary differential equations by perturbation technique and are solved numerically by using the shooting method. The effects of the various parameters on the velocity, temperature and concentration profiles are presented graphically and the skin-friction coefficient, Nusselt number and Sherwood number at the plate are shown in Tables. %K Variable viscosity %K Thermal conductivity %K MHD %K Vertical plate %U http://ijamc.darbose.in/ijamc/index.php/ijamc/article/view/36
